Manchester City vs Chelsea Prediction: 25/1/2025

The duel between Manchester City and Chelsea at the Etihad Stadium would be a really fascinating encounter of two footballing powerhouses. On Saturday, January 25, 2025, at 18:30, this might be an important game for both sides in the hunt for vital points against each other. Sixth-placed City are awaiting fifth-placed Chelsea, divided only by two points, which will make this clash bigger.

Manchester City Recent Form and Home Advantage

Despite an inconsistent start to the season, Manchester City have shown glimpses of their trademark dominance. The club currently sits sixth with 35 points from 21 matches, working to reclaim a spot among the league’s top contenders. Recently, they have been in good form, managing three wins and two draws in their last five outings across all competitions, showing their ability to secure results even when not at their best.

City fought hard for a 2-2 draw away to Brentford in their last outing, showing character to come from behind twice to take a point. It’s home form, though, that has been the strong suit, with six wins and two draws at the Etihad this season, with only two losses. All in all, with 38 goals scored and 29 conceded, Pep Guardiola’s side does look like it is starting to find its rhythm.

This, in essence, is a team managed by Guardiola: possessing the ball and never giving opponents an inch. Guardiola will seek to take advantage of Chelsea’s frailties while keeping City’s excellent run at home intact.

Chelsea’s Mixed Campaign

Chelsea are fifth with 37 points under the management of Vincenzo Maresca. The Blues have been brilliant at times this season but inconsistency has been a problem. In the last five matches in all competitions, Chelsea have won once, drawn twice, and lost twice. Their most recent result was a 2-2 home draw against Bournemouth, which showed them at both their attacking best and defensively poor.

Despite the ups and downs, Chelsea have a good away record, with six wins, three draws, and only two defeats. They also have the attacking power to disturb any strong rear guard, having scored 41 goals and conceded 26. Maresca has implemented a system that emphasizes rapid transitions and exploitation of spaces behind opponents-something that could give City’s defensive organization a stern test, especially if Chelsea delivers on counter-attacks.

Recent Encounters and Head-to-Head Record

The previous encounter between these two sides saw Manchester City win 2-0 at Stamford Bridge-a result that will certainly make City more confident coming into this game. In the last five meetings in all competitions, City have a clear advantage with three wins, while the other two matches ended in draws. Chelsea’s failure to win in that time will also be a worry for Maresca and the team.

Form Comparison

City are unbeaten in their last five games with three wins and two draws, while Chelsea have been less convincing of late, with just one win, coupled with two draws and two defeats.

Prediction

While both teams have the quality to win the match, Manchester City’s strong home record, recent form, and historical success in this fixture give them a significant edge. Chelsea’s good away record and attacking talent suggest they can find the net, so a high-scoring match could be on the cards.

We predict Manchester City will win the game, as it is Guardiola’s tactical acumen and team dominance at Etihad that make the difference. Chelsea, though, can be expected to give a good fight in what will be an entertaining and closely contested encounter.

Prediction: Manchester City 2 : 1 Chelsea
